CloudJavaKubernetesOraclePostgresAICollaborationRemote Work
About this role
Role Overview
Join the Platform Services team as a high-impact IC (individual contributor)
Contribute immediately to designing, building, and operating internal platforms and services
Work effectively in a distributed team spanning London and North America
Provide senior-level autonomy in North American hours so progress continues even when the London-based team is offline
Design, implement, and maintain backend services and platform capabilities primarily in Java
Deploy and operate services on Kubernetes and virtualized infrastructure in an on-premises environment (no public cloud providers)
Work with Postgres and Oracle databases as core data stores
Contribute to and sometimes lead system design and architecture discussions, particularly for internal access management platforms and trade limits platforms used by risk and compliance stakeholders
Collaborate with engineers in London and North America using a mix of pair programming and asynchronous collaboration
Own work from design through implementation, automated testing, deployment, and production support (full lifecycle ownership)
Use AI-assisted development tools while maintaining high code quality and robust review practices
Participate in and improve team practices around code review, operational excellence, and documentation
Requirements
Strong experience as a Senior Software Engineer or equivalent level
Solid Java development experience in production systems
Experience deploying to and operating on Kubernetes (on-prem or self-managed clusters preferred)
Working knowledge of relational databases (Postgres and/or Oracle)
Comfortable working close to infrastructure and platform concerns (deployment, environments, access, configuration, observability)
Proven track record with system design and architecture for complex backend/platform systems
Experience in full lifecycle development
Familiarity with or openness to AI-assisted development tools and workflows
Ability to operate with high autonomy in North American working hours